trailape | 11 Dec 2011 2:55 p.m. PST |
Hi Guys Can anyone recommend good Hanovarian Flags for Waterloo? I suspect GMB and Maverik Models are the best options. I also assume each Battalion carried two colours. Can anyone provide details? I'm looking at the Landwehr. Cheers |

Connard Sage | 11 Dec 2011 3:18 p.m. PST |
Only one colour per battalion. Maverick, excellent as they are, have but a single Landwehr flag listed – Battalion Gifhorn. |

photocrinch | 11 Dec 2011 7:07 p.m. PST |
There are very few examples of actual Hanoverian flags carried in 1815, which is why there are so few available. TMP link The following link has an actual picture of the flag carried by the Hoya Battalion: link David |
